4-Day Itinerary: Exploring Mathura & Vrindavan

Viewed by 201 travelers

Day 1: Arrival & Spiritual Introduction in Mathura

Morning: Arrive in Mathura and settle into your accommodation. Begin the day with a visit to the Shri Krishna Janmabhoomi Temple, believed to be the birthplace of Lord Krishna, soaking in the spiritual atmosphere.

Afternoon: Enjoy a traditional lunch, then explore the Vishram Ghat on the banks of the Yamuna River, a vibrant place of ritual baths and prayers. Take a leisurely walk along the riverside and observe the local religious festivities.

Evening: Witness the captivating evening arti (prayer ceremony) at the Kusum Sarovar, marveling at the illuminated temples and the serene environment that surrounds this historic site.

Day 2: Deeper into Mathura’s Heritage

Morning: Visit the ancient Drashti Dhami Temple and the Gita Mandir, where you can learn more about Lord Krishna’s teachings. The architecture and inscriptions offer a rich cultural insight.

Afternoon: Head to the Mathura Museum, showcasing a superb collection of artifacts, sculptures, and coins from the region's past. Afterward, enjoy a local meal at a nearby eatery.

Evening: Spend a peaceful evening strolling through the bustling Mathura Market, picking up souvenirs like sweets, handicrafts, and religious items before enjoying dinner with traditional delicacies.

Day 3: Exploring Vrindavan’s Divine Charm

Morning: Travel to Vrindavan, starting with the beautiful Banke Bihari Temple, one of the most beloved temples dedicated to Lord Krishna. The early hours are perfect for a serene experience.

Afternoon: Visit the ISKCON Temple, renowned for its vibrant celebrations and spiritual teachings. After lunch, explore the Prem Mandir, a magnificent marble temple known for its detailed carvings and garden.

Evening: Enjoy the peaceful ambiance at the Yamuna River Ghats, where you can witness devotional music and dance performances or participate in an evening arti along the riverbank.

Day 4: Vrindavan’s Serenity & Departure

Morning: Visit the Nidhivan forest, a mystical place associated with Krishna’s eternal dance, followed by the Radha Raman Temple, famous for its ancient idol and architecture.

Afternoon: Relax with a light lunch and a final walk through the Seva Kunj Garden, soaking in the lush surroundings and spiritual history. Prepare for departure with some last-minute shopping or quiet reflection.

Evening: Depart from Vrindavan or Mathura, taking with you memories of a soulful journey through divine heritage and vibrant culture.

Time and Cost Estimates

  • Shri Krishna Janmabhoomi Temple – 2 hours – Free entrance
  • Vishram Ghat – 1.5 hours – Free
  • Kusum Sarovar Evening Arti – 1 hour – Free
  • Drashti Dhami Temple & Gita Mandir – 2 hours – Free
  • Mathura Museum – 1.5 hours – Approx. ₹50 (~$0.60)
  • Mathura Market Shopping – 2 hours – Variable, approx. ₹500 (~$6.00)
  • Banke Bihari Temple – 1.5 hours – Free
  • ISKCON Temple – 2 hours – Free
  • Prem Mandir – 1.5 hours – Entry donation approx. ₹100 (~$1.20)
  • Yamuna River Ghats Arti – 1 hour – Free
  • Nidhivan & Radha Raman Temple – 2 hours – Free
  • Seva Kunj Garden – 1 hour – Free

Total estimated cost for entrance fees and donations: Approx. ₹650 (~$7.80)

Tips

If you wish to extend your trip, consider spending extra days exploring nearby towns like Barsana or Govardhan for an enriched spiritual experience. Conversely, to reduce the duration, focus on the key temples in Mathura and Vrindavan, prioritizing the Shri Krishna Janmabhoomi and Banke Bihari Temple, to fit the highlights into a 2-day itinerary.
